So, what exactly Laminates are? Laminate veneer can be classically demarcated as a kind of engineered wood that is broadly used for furniture, cabinets, and flooring. The word 'laminate veneer' can mention any product made of a thin face layer pasted onto a core, where the topmost layer is made of whatever from wood to marble to plastic. Since many ages, these decor products are in use.
Among diverse types of veneers, the most prevalent type of laminate veneer is real wood veneer. It is prepared by slicing thin layers of wood and gluing them to a hard core, the grain outline of the wood can be repeated often over a surface, which is generally not conceivable with solid materials. The most well-known and popular real wood veneer are made up of thin layers where wood are compacted together using an adhesive. The inner layers are prepared using some type of plywood or are manufactured with composite wood product that is unaffected to shrinking, bending, and distorting. The topmost layer of face layer is made of a very thin slice of natural hardwood, commonly carved out a whole log. The wood then may bent into the required shape using high-pressure molds, or by smearing steam to the wood and twisting it over a jig.
